- A Billy Bob is a strong-armed enemy found throughout the many caverns of Glitter Gulch Mine. They resemble Grublins from Banjo-Kazooie. These cowboy-baddies hide buried in the ground with only their hats visible and spring up with a characteristic "Yee-haw!" to attack Banjo and Kazooie. Fortunately, they are not remarkably sturdy or speedy, so they can easily be defeated or simply outrun.
- An obese redneck, Billy Bob is often shown wearing only a cowboy hat and briefs. He appears fully clothed in Heroes as the owner of a skeet shooting establishment. He wears stereotypical redneck clothes such as a tight-fitting green T-shirt, white jeans and cowboy boots. He often smokes a cigar. Billy Bob is not to be confused with the similar (and similarly-named) character Bill. A similar character to Billy Bob is featured in the 2011 episode, Massage (Which the boys had to massage him or else they'll go the jail). His name is not stated, but could be an older and more obese version of Billy Bob. Voiced by Mike Judge.
